SI-9008 Fix regression with higher kinded existentials
Allow a naked type constructor in an existential type if
we are directly within a type application.
Recently, 84d4671 changed nested context creation to avoid passing
down the `TypeConstructorAllowed`, which led to missing kind errors
in code like `type T[({type M = List})#M]`.
However, when typechecking `T forSome { quantifiers }`, we create
a nested context to represent the nested scope introduced for the
quantifiers. But we need to propagate the `TypeConstructorAllowed`
bit to the nested context to allow for higher kinded existentials.
The enclosed tests show:
- pos/t9008 well kinded application of an hk existential
- neg/t9008 hk existential forbidden outside of type application
- neg/t9008b kind error reported for hk existential
Regressed in 84d4671.
